Chief Operating Officer at Welling Young, LLC in Richmond, Virginia

Job Description:

The Chief Operations Officer ("COO") position is an executive level position responsible for overseeing and directing the Company's agency operations (other than sales and service). The COO position will specifically drive the design, development and execution of our IT, systems support and infrastructure, project management, enterprise risk management, innovation/technology, quality control/quality assurance, licensing, strategic implementation and real estate initiatives that are needed to support a Top 100 commercial Insurance brokerage organization. The COO will be responsible for developing and then executing various strategic initiatives that drive and enhance the Company's core operational efficiency, allowing for growth and expansion, as well as to increase the Company's overall profitability.

The COO will partner with the CEO and be a member of and work closely with the Executive Management Team, in support of the growth objectives of the Company. The COO position requires elements of both strategy and execution, as well as the ability to collaborate across the entire Company (and industry as a whole), in order to successfully execute the Company's mission.

Successful candidates will need to demonstrate that they have a proven track record for managing the various operations for a commercial insurance brokerage, including a good working knowledge of agency management systems, as well as to possess a strategic mindset and be able to work in a dynamic, results driven operating environment. Successful candidates must also be able to lead, coach, mentor, motivate, recruit and train various team members in support of the Company's strategic initiatives.

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Set the strategic direction and then oversee the Company's daily operations with respect to IT, Systems support, Operations, Compliance, Quality Control, Innovation, Real Estate, Enterprise Risk Management and Compliance and manage those respective initiatives and teams accordingly.
  • Lead the Company's vendor management process, ensuring compliance with current best-practices regarding vendor agreements, ongoing relationships, risk management and vendor compliance.
  • Identify and implement new technologies that can support the Company's strategic goals and allow the Company to scale and grow.
  • Determine best approach to leverage the Company's data and analytics in order to a.) allow the Company to make informed decisions about how best to service our clients and b.) offer our clients a more robust client experience.
  • Lead the Company's Innovation initiatives, including fostering a culture of innovation and continuous improvement to allow the Company to achieve its growth objectives. Represent the Company at various Broker-Tech industry forums that serve to drive ideation, investment and innovation in the Insurance Brokerage space. Should the Company choose to become a participant in one of the Broker-Tech ventures, the COO would be the Company's primary liaison, interacting with various industry thought leaders and providing our Company's viewpoint and input to those forums.
  • Ensure both regulatory and Company policy compliance regarding systems and data integrity, ensuring that the Company's data is secure.
  • Oversees the training and education of the Company's employees with regards to systems and other data security policies and procedures.
  • Responsible for developing and adhering to a budget, managing expenses accordingly.

Required Skills:
  • This position requires a broad set of skills, including strategic and customer-centric thinking.
  • Previous experience as department head, team leader or other senior level position supporting the operations of an Insurance Brokerage operation.
  • Bachelor's degree
  • Demonstrated success in managing and leading a professional team of IT, Systems and Operations professionals.
  • Must possess the required technical skills needed to support the Company's IT and Operations infrastructure
  • Demonstrated visibility within the insurance brokerage space and be able to interact with various industry experts while representing the Company
  • High degree of integrity and desire to work in a fast-paced, dynamic professional environment
  • Must be able to think strategically and be able to execute on those strategic plans
  • Must be able to work in a budget-oriented environment
